Abstract
Metabolic dysfunction-associated steatotic liver disease (MASLD) is the most prevalent chronic liver disease worldwide.
- MASLD is characterized by liver fat accumulation, inflammation, and progressive scarring.
- Cellular senescence is identified as a significant factor in the initiation and progression of MASLD.
- Senescence occurs in various liver cell types, including hepatocytes and non-parenchymal cells.
- Senescent cells contribute to disease progression through specific mechanisms and communication between cell types.
- Targeting cellular senescence shows promise as a therapeutic approach for MASLD, although challenges remain.
- Preclinical studies on senolytics and other senescence-targeting strategies face issues with cell diversity and safety.
